Gluggle Jug

July 27, 2014

Sometimes I surprise myself with pieces that catch my eye,like this Gluggle jug.

Interesting name isn’t it?

light blue gluggle jug

This is nothing new,I actually have had my eye on this for many years.

And just recently I decided I needed to bring one home.

I think the color is something I fell for too.

gluggle jug

It’s definitely a conversation piece.

This Gluggle jug is from England.

It gets is name from the sound it makes when you pour the water into a glass it makes a glug,glug sound.

I will be using this mostly for our lemon water.

Yes I still enjoy my large mason jar,but it can be a pain filling it up.

This is much smaller and easier to fill and clean.

lemon water

Besides using this for lemon water,I think this would be great for Margaritas!

Someone on instagram mentioned filling it with wine and using it as a wine decanter.

gluggle jug

You can also use this to store you kitchen utensils,or as a vase.

But I like the fun idea of pouring and hearing that glug,glug!

This color works perfectly in my kitchen too,but they do have other pretty colors.

I also have a matching coffee creamer.
